Strickland Introduces Bipartisan Legislation To Combat Fentanyl Overdose Crisis Among Adolescents
Washington, D.C. – U.S. Representative Marilyn Strickland (WA-10) alongside fellow Representatives Dan Newhouse (WA-04), Kim Schrier (WA-08), Derek Kilmer (WA-06), Ryan Zinke (MT-01), and John Moolenaar (MI-02), re-introduced the Stop Overdose in Schools Act. This bipartisan legislation would secure funding for naloxone training and purchasing, and would increase naloxone access for school resource officers, security personnel, and school nurses.…
